Marble grit floors were very much in vogue in Italy in past decades. They were very common in our grandmothers’ homes, as they were a cheaper alternative to other types of materials.
Although they have gone out of fashion, marble grit floors are still present in our homes, and they retain great charm, especially when they are original and antique.
Not to mention that marble grit is also very resistant to knocks and wear. Our grandparents were right to prefer it.
The only drawback of this type of flooring is that they tend to lose their classic shine. But there is no need to fear: you can thoroughly clean and polish marble grit floors with all-natural ingredients.
